I have a debit card issued in Serbia. My main currency is set to USD on my PayPal account. I have options to store my balance in USD, EUR or RSD (local value) on my debit card. When I change my balance to USD on my debit card and I want to pay via PayPal online it still bills in RSD and takes more money than it should. How can I pay in USD?

Your local currency is your country currency,so Paypal will charge you 3% for currency conversion,unless you have USD balance in your paypal account,not in your debit card.
if your debit card has US$,move it to your Paypal ccount first before buying,not sure if Paypal would not do a currency conversion,it has to do with the way how Paypal access the network to reach you card?
